Transaction 706419ea6b668d917244af5fc84cf831c9a2275d9b57ec2d66d2f9ee236b3544

2 Input
2 Outputs
  • 706419ea6b668d917244af5fc84cf831c9a2275d9b57ec2d66d2f9ee236b3544:0
  • value  67584127
    address  13YcwyMWpVEmM7iKAbyXJkX6q7p3DqtoTD
  • 706419ea6b668d917244af5fc84cf831c9a2275d9b57ec2d66d2f9ee236b3544:1
  • value  100000000
    address  17j3MKPpaGirCBCgquqoqtK5GaPJ8n6rMp